禁止将BGP的路由条目通过重发布BGP AS方式引入RIP及OSPF中什么意思
时间: 2024-01-10 18:02:40 浏览: 173
禁止将BGP的路由条目通过重发布BGP AS方式引入RIP及OSPF中,意味着不允许BGP协议中的路由信息被发布到RIP和OSPF协议中,从而防止不同路由协议之间的互通。这种情况下,不同路由协议之间的路由信息无法相互学习和交换,可能导致网络中的某些子网无法被访问或者出现路由环路等问题。禁止重发布BGP路由到RIP和OSPF协议中需要通过相应的路由配置命令来实现,具体命令可参考网络设备的配置手册。
相关问题
禁止将BGP的路由条目通过重发布BGP AS方式引入RIP及OSPF中;禁止将RIP、OSPF的路由条目通过重发布整个进程方式引入BGP中;
为了禁止将BGP的路由条目通过重发布BGP AS方式引入RIP及OSPF中,可以在S5和S6上配置如下的路由过滤器:
```
ip prefix-list BGP-TO-RIP-OSPF seq 5 permit <BGP路由的网络地址> <子网掩码>
!
route-map BGP-TO-RIP-OSPF permit 10
match ip address prefix-list BGP-TO-RIP-OSPF
!
router rip
distribute-list route-map BGP-TO-RIP-OSPF in
!
router ospf <进程号>
distribute-list route-map BGP-TO-RIP-OSPF in
```
这样配置后,只有匹配路由过滤器中指定的BGP路由才会被分发到RIP和OSPF协议中。
为了禁止将RIP、OSPF的路由条目通过重发布整个进程方式引入BGP中,可以在R1和R2上配置如下的路由过滤器:
```
access-list 1 deny 0.0.0.0
access-list 1 permit any
!
router bgp <AS号>
redistribute ospf <进程号> metric 10 route-map OSPF-TO-BGP
redistribute rip metric 10 route-map RIP-TO-BGP
!
route-map OSPF-TO-BGP permit 10
match ip address 1
!
route-map RIP-TO-BGP permit 10
match ip address 1
```
这样配置后,只有匹配路由过滤器中指定的RIP和OSPF路由才会被重发到BGP协议中,而排除了整个进程的路由。同时,由于设置了metric值为10,避免了重复路由的出现。
禁止将BGP的路由条目通过重发布BGP AS方式引入RIP及OSPF中,禁止将RIP、OSPF的路由条目通过重发布整个进程方式引入BGP中。怎么配置
可以通过在BGP进程中使用route-map来实现。下面是其中一种可能的配置方法:
1. 禁止将BGP的路由条目通过重发布BGP AS方式引入RIP及OSPF中:
```
route-map BGP-to-RIP-OSPF deny 10
match as-path 10
!
access-list 10 permit ^$
access-list 10 deny .*
!
router bgp <AS号>
neighbor <S5的IP> remote-as <S5的AS号>
neighbor <S6的IP> remote-as <S6的AS号>
neighbor <S5的IP> route-map BGP-to-RIP-OSPF out
neighbor <S6的IP> route-map BGP-to-RIP-OSPF out
!
router rip
version 2
network <RIP网络号>
redistribute bgp 1 route-map BGP-to-RIP-OSPF
!
router ospf <OSPF进程号>
network <OSPF网络号> area <区域号>
redistribute bgp 1 route-map BGP-to-RIP-OSPF
```
这里我们定义了一个名为 BGP-to-RIP-OSPF 的route-map,使用access-list 10来匹配空AS号的路由,然后拒绝所有其他路由。在BGP进程中,将此route-map应用于向S5和S6邻居发送的路由,并在RIP、OSPF进程中使用redistribute bgp命令将BGP路由发布到RIP、OSPF中,但是只有那些AS号为空的路由被重发布。
2. 禁止将RIP、OSPF的路由条目通过重发布整个进程方式引入BGP中:
```
route-map RIP-OSPF-to-BGP deny 10
match ip address prefix-list RIP-OSPF-routes
!
ip prefix-list RIP-OSPF-routes permit <RIP网络号>
ip prefix-list RIP-OSPF-routes permit <OSPF网络号>
!
router bgp <AS号>
neighbor <R1的IP> remote-as <R1的AS号>
neighbor <R2的IP> remote-as <R2的AS号>
neighbor <R1的IP> route-map RIP-OSPF-to-BGP in
neighbor <R2的IP> route-map RIP-OSPF-to-BGP in
!
```
这里我们定义了一个名为 RIP-OSPF-to-BGP 的route-map,使用prefix-list RIP-OSPF-routes来匹配RIP和OSPF进程中的路由,然后拒绝所有这些路由。在BGP进程中,将此route-map应用于从R1和R2邻居接收的路由,这样可以防止RIP和OSPF中的路由进入BGP进程。
阅读全文